Description of Farming While Black: Soul Fire Farm’s Practical Guide to Liberation on the Land
"Farming While Black is a beautiful and timely work that manages to live at once as a stunning memoir of the extraordinary life of Leah Penniman and her Soul Fire Farm; a methodical and innovative instruction manual for a sustainable farm practice; and a clear-eyed manifesto that uses the rich history of the Black farming legacy as the guiding ethos for an effective modern day resistance movement."—Therese Nelson, chef and writer; founder of blackculinaryhistory.com
